Mining in Goa is done by open cast method which necessitated the removal of overburden overlying the iron ore formations. On an average 2.3 tons of mining waste has to be removed in order to produce a ton of iron ore. The average annual production of iron ore is of the order of 15-16 million tons and in this process about 40 - 50 million tons of mining waste is generated. Such a huge quality ...

25.09.2011 · The supracrustals that constitute the Goa Group of Gokul et al. (1985) can be divided into two lithostratigraphic sequences namely the Barcem Group and the Ponda Group. The former comprises predominantly greenstones (metabasalts) and rests on a basement of the 3300–3400 Ma Anmode Ghat trodhjemite gneiss with a crudely developed quartz-pebble conglomerate at the base, and shows …

iron-formation (BIF) is the most common name used in USA, Canada, Australia and South America, and is mostly used in a lithologic sense. Wnen the words are capitalized and nonhyphenated like Iron Formation, it implies the corresponding stratigraphic unit (Brandt et al, 1973; Kimberley, 1978).

Mining in Goa today is synonymous with iron ore mining. Exploration for Iron ore started at the beginning of the 20th Centaury. Present day mining resumed in 1947 which marks the beginning of modern day mining and export of iron ore. The exports have steadily increased from 4,36,400 tonnes of iron ore in 1951 to 35 million tones in 2008-09. The Goan iron ore is exported to China, Japan, Taiwan, South …
